Support for Commercialization of Startup Items in the Marine and Fisheries Sector

[Sejong=Asia Economy Reporter Kwon Haeyoung] The Ministry of Oceans and Fisheries announced on the 12th that it has selected 40 companies to receive funding for prototype production, improvement, and promotional marketing to commercialize promising startup items in the marine and fisheries sector.


Since 2018, the Ministry has been implementing the "Marine and Fisheries Startup Commercialization Fund Support Program," which provides funding for research and development, product verification, and overseas expansion to marine and fisheries companies within seven years of establishment. Through this program, a total of 46 companies were supported over three years until 2020, contributing to approximately 14.5 billion KRW in sales and the creation of 62 new jobs.


Due to the prolonged COVID-19 pandemic worsening business conditions, this year the support amount per company has been increased to 30 million KRW from 25 million KRW last year. The number of supported companies has also more than doubled from 18 to 40.



Kim Inkyung, Director of the Marine and Fisheries Science and Technology Policy Division at the Ministry, said, "We hope that this commercialization fund support will help turn promising marine and fisheries technologies into products and lead to future sales growth. We will continue to strengthen the discovery of promising startups in the marine and fisheries sector and provide follow-up support."
